1-Hydroxy-4-prenylnaphthalene is a naturally occurring organic compound characterized by a naphthalene core, which is a bicyclic aromatic hydrocarbon. This specific compound features a hydroxyl group (-OH) at the 1st position and a prenyl group (a C5H9 unit derived from isoprene) attached at the 4th position. It is known for its presence in various plants and has been studied for its potential biological activities, such as antioxidant properties and possible roles in plant defense mechanisms. The prenylation of the naphthalene ring in 1-hydroxy-4-prenylnaphthalene contributes to its unique chemical reactivity and may influence its interactions within biological systems.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 2960-04-5 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 2,9,6 and 0 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 0 and 4 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 2960-04:
(6*2)+(5*9)+(4*6)+(3*0)+(2*0)+(1*4)=85
85 % 10 = 5
So 2960-04-5 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

TWO NAPHTHOPYRAN DERIVATIVES FROM FARAMEA CYANEA

Ferrari, F.,Monache, G. Delle,Lima, R. Alves

, p. 2753 - 2755 (1985)

Four anthraquinones and two new products, faramol (3,4-dihydro-3-hydroxy-2,2-dimethyl-2H-naphthopyran) and 7-methoxyfaramol (3,4-dihydro-3-hydroxy-7-methoxy-2,2-dimethyl-2H-naphthopyran), have been isolated from Faramea cyanea. Water-Accelerated Claisen Rearrangements

Wipf, Peter,Rodriguez, Sonia

, p. 434 - 440 (2007/10/03)

Allyl aryl ethers undergo accelerated Claisen and [1,3] rearrangements in the presence of a mixture of trialkylalanes and water or aluminoxanes. The ratio of ortho-, meta-, and pora-Claisen products depends to a large extent on the presence of water and to a much lesser extent on the nature of the alane.
